Alibaba's Qwen3.8-Max-0902 tops CodeArena WebDev leaderboard with 2.4T parameters and $5/MToken pricing
Alibaba's Qwen team released Qwen3.8-Max-0902, a 2.4 trillion-parameter AI model with a 1 million token context window. It achieved the number one position on the CodeArena WebDev leaderboard with a score of 1691 and leads the Pareto frontier at $5 per million tokens. The model, post-trained on coding and cowork tasks, is available via API on QwenCloud for enterprise and scientific applications.

Alibaba's Qwen3.8-Max-0902 tops Code Arena WebDev, surpassing Claude Opus 5
Alibaba's Qwen team released Qwen3.8-Max-0902, an updated version of its large language model released just a month prior. The model retains 2.4 trillion parameters and 1 million context length but shows significant improvements in coding and agent capabilities. On the Code Arena WebDev benchmark, it scored 1691 points, ranking first globally and surpassing Claude Opus 5 by 3 points. The model also achieved a 22-point improvement over the previous version. On several other benchmarks including QwenSWEBench V2 (70.0), it outperformed Opus 5 (68.0). The model is priced at approximately $5 per million tokens based on Arena's 3:1 input-output mixed pricing. The post highlights a trend in frontier AI competition where post-training improvements on existing base models can yield substantial performance gains without changing the model name.

Alibaba Qwen releases Qwen3.8-Max-0902 with 2.4T parameters and 1M context tokens
Alibaba's Qwen team announced the upgrade of its Qwen3.8-Max model to version Qwen3.8-Max-0902. The new model features 2.4 trillion parameters and a 1 million token context window, designed for real-world complexity. It has been further post-trained on coding and cowork tasks, delivering stronger performance across complex enterprise tasks, scientific research, and long-horizon workflows. Pricing is set at $2 per million input tokens and $6 per million output tokens, with cache hit rates at $0.17 for explicit and $0.25 for implicit. The model is now available via API on QwenCloud.
